“Disinformation thrives in an information vacuum,” said CSDI Director Heidi Tworek at the Vancouver International Security Summit. She urged “pre-bunking” falsehoods, improving media literacy, and regulating platforms to protect democracy. Learn more: bowenislandundercurrent.com/highlights/sec…
